/**
|
|
* Adaptive red-green subdivision. Triangles are tessellated to their specified level while also ensuring crack- and T-junction-free triangulation across
|
|
* triangles with different tessellation levels.
|
|
*
|
|
* Each "triangle level" is the number of times to repeatedly apply red subdivision (1 to 4 triangle splits). We must simultaneously apply green subdivision on
|
|
* neighboring triangles with lower levels to resolve T-junctions.
|
|
*/
